### Step 4: Deploy the Pooler

Before restarting Confluent Creek's connection pooler (PoolMinder), confirm the new binary's signature — support has seen corrupted downloads cause silent pool exhaustion, which looks like a database outage but isn't. Run the verifier against the artifact before copying it to the app hosts, and only proceed if it reports a clean match. Verify using the deploy key shown below.

rollout seal: bky4_x7Gc

For this week's sync: the Pixwren upload path now scrubs EXIF data—GPS coordinates, device serials, and timestamps—before any image reaches storage. Scrubbing happens in the Quillgate worker, never client-side, so nothing sensitive persists even transiently. The worker verifies payloads against the Quillgate signing service, and the next line sets the credential it uses.

vault entry, kafog-yahop: COURIER_KEY8=0faa53ae

## Deploying the Gatewick Proctor Queue

Deploys are pretty painless: push to main, wait for the pipeline, then watch the queue drain dashboard for five minutes. If candidates pile up mid-exam, roll back first and ask questions later — the queue replays safely. Everything the workers care about lives in one config block, shown here for reference.

settings of bafof-yagef:
JOROX_PIN=8740
JOROX_TENANT=pelox
JOROX_METRICS_HOST=metrics.jorox.qorvelworks.internal
JOROX_SEAL=seal_c78f63c1
JOROX_STANDBY_TEAM=norax

## Licensing Dispute: Quorvath Analytics (Managers Only)

For the finance team. Quorvath Analytics claims our use of their Lexiron engine in the Pardale product line breaches the redistribution clause signed in 2021. Legal considers the claim partially valid and is negotiating a revised fee schedule. Accrue a contingency in the Q3 close; amount to be confirmed by counsel. Expect resolution within two quarters. The implications for our forward business plans are set out in the confidential note below.

confidential, bahap-bajog: Zorethix Works is in early talks to buy Kelethox Foods for about $30.7 million. The Ralvan launch date is September 19, and nothing goes to the press before then.